Cpl. Jimmy L. Shelton, 21, of Lehigh Acres, Fla. 1st Squadron, 33rd Cavalry Regiment, 3rd Brigade Combat Team, 101st Airborne Division, based at Fort Campbell, Ky. Killed Dec. 3 in Baiji.
Spec. Brian A. Wright, 19, of Keensburg, Ill. Army National Guard 135th Engineer Company, based in Lawrenceville, Ill. Killed Dec. 6 in Ramadi.
Pfc. Thomas C. Siekert, 20, of Lovelock, Nev. 1st Battalion, 187th Infantry Regiment, 3rd Brigade Combat Team 101st Airborne Division, based at Fort Campbell, Ky. Died Dec. 6 in Baiji of noncombat injuries.
Cpl. Joseph P. Bier, 22, of Centralia, Wash. 3rd Battalion, 7th Marine Regiment, 1st Marine Division, 1st Marine Expeditionary Force, based in Twentynine Palms, Calif. Killed Dec. 7 in Ramadi.
All troops were killed in action unless otherwise indicated.
Total fatalities include five civilian employees of the Defense Department.
